Brief Description:  Pass Through for Throttle/Mixture Cables

I fabricated (2) firewall pass through fittings...
Using the same concept as the carb heat cable pass-through, as in photo #1.
Although the carb heat cable fitting was purchased, I was unable to find the correct size for the throttle/mixture cables. So, i copied the design, it worked just fine...

Started with a AN832-8D, and its associated hardware, photo #2.
I cut the short end nipple off, sanded flush and primed. This will be on the engine side of F/W.
Reamed the inside diameter of the -8D fitting to 1/2".
Cut slots in the tappered threaded end, Photo #3.

Once you route the cable through, and tighten things up the slots allow it to squeeze the cable gently to hold it tight with no movement. Really turned out nice. The Final assembly will be fire sealed, and torqued as required.

This design seemed the simplest, and robust I could come up with...
I just could not see punching 1" holes for some of the eye type pass-throughs...
